Planting Calendar for Arctotis

Frost tolerance for arctotis: Tolerant of some frost.
When to plant: Up to 5 weeks before last frost.

Arctotis tend to make it in mild cold which tells us that you can plant them a little earlier in the year than plants that are more sensitive to the cold.

The earliest that you can plant arctotis in Fayette is February. However, you really should wait until March if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ant arctotis and expect a good harvest is probably September. If you wait any later than that and your arctotis may not have a chance to grow to maturity. Starting your arctotis indoors is a great way to get them started a little bit earlier.

Last Frost Date

On average the last frost when the weather gets warmer is on April 15 in Fayette. In the coldest months of winter you can expect an average low temperature of 5°F.

Since the USDA zone info for Fayette is an average the actual date of last frost can change quite a bit from year to year. Since half of the time in Fayette it frosts late in the year after April 15 be ready to protect your arctotis if you have a late frost.

USDA Zone Info for Fayette

Here is the info for USDA Zone 7b.

Average Date of Last Frost (spring)April 15
Average Date of First Frost (fall)October 15
Lowest Expected Low5°F
Highest Expected Low10°F

This means that on a really cold year, the coldest it will get is 5°F. On most years you should be prepared to experience lows near 10°F.
